Join the ranks as a Weapons Engineering Technician in the Canadian Armed Forces, focusing on the maintenance of advanced electronic systems on naval vessels. Your role is integral to ensuring communication and navigation systems operate effectively.

As a technician, you will work in agile environments, performing repairs and diagnostics on various electronic applications. This position includes critical training and hands-on experience with weapons systems, radar, and sonar.

Key Responsibilities:
• Operate and assess electronic diagnostic systems
• Repair and maintain shipboard electronics
• Compile evaluations and test logs
• Inspect and install electronic components
• Read and interpret electronic schematic drawings

Requirements:
• Must have Grade 10 or Secondary 4 education
• Physics coursework is beneficial as an asset
• A college diploma or Red Seal in a related field preferred
• Full completion of Basic Military Qualification needed
• Adaptable to maritime working conditions

Utilize your training and skills in electronics to ensure the functionality of critical systems aboard naval operations.
